Determine the slope and y-intercept from the following equation y=3/2x+3

Respuesta :

xxamari
xxamari xxamari
  • 04-05-2020

Answer:

slope: 3/2

y-intercept: 3

Step-by-step explanation:

This equation is in the form y=mx + b, where m=slope and b=y-intercept.

y = 3/2x + 3

m = 3/2 = slope

b = 3 = y-intercept
